North Korea again test-fired a ballistic missile

MNA International Desk: North Korea test-fired a ballistic missile on Saturday shortly after U.S. Secretary of State Rex Tillerson warned that failure to curb its nuclear and ballistic missile programs could lead to ‘catastrophic consequences’, reported news agency.

Military options for dealing with the North were still “on the table”, Tillerson warned in his first address to the UN body.

The latest launch, which South Korea said was a failure, ratchets up tensions on the Korean peninsula, with Washington and Pyongyang locked in an ever-tighter spiral of threat, counter-threat, and escalating military preparedness.

US President Donald Trump, who has warned of a “major conflict” with North Korean leader Kim Jong-Un’s regime, said the latest test was a pointed snub to China—the North’s main ally and economic lifeline.
